Washington and Lee University is a very small not-for-profit college offering many disciplines along with the economics major and located in Lexington, Virginia. The school was founded in 1749 and is presently offering bachelor's degrees in General Economics.

Washington and Lee University is among the most expensive in the country - depending on the program, tuition price is around $65,000 per year. If you seek a cheaper alternative, check Affordable Colleges in Virginia listing.

It is reported that Washington and Lee University area is dangerous - the school is reported to have a bad rating for on-campus safety.

Based on 66 evaluation factors, Washington and Lee University economics program ranks #120 Economics School (out of 1023; top 15%) in USA and in Top 5 Economics Schools in Virginia. Major competing economics schools for this college are Princeton University and Duke University in Durham.
